You can remove it with root as described above. I wouldn't do it though. Others mentioned in a number of posts that it's needed for other messengers to function.

I can confirm. Removing mms.apk will cause you to lose functionality. You will be able to send and recieve regular texts, but multimedia (pics, vids) will no longer appear when sent to the phone... Consider my findings a "D'oh" moment. :)

...fyi do not deleted your stock messaging app from your Droid 1 ..I did that when I first rooted and believe me...you won't get texts. Handcent didn't show any text messages coming in at all. I wanted to do this so when I do a wipe I wouldn't have to restore 11,000 messages (remember both messaging services have a copy), but this is the only way to have it. Definitley get SMS Backup/Restore from the market, it backs up all conversations and stores them on your SD, best part is its free. Titanium backup will save your app settings so you can rest easy during a wipe. Hope this helps.
